Day 1: Monday 22 March 2021 Fly Christchurch to Napier D

Upon arriving in Napier you will be transported to the award winning Masonic Hotel and the 1930’s. Opened in 1861 the Masonic Hotel has had a difficult past, being razed by fire twice by 1931. The 7.9 Napier Earthquake was the catalyst for the Masonic Hotel’s iconic Art Deco design, like Napier itself, this historic hotel has captured Art Deco Style of the 1930’s perfectly, and after a recent refurbishment is a destination unto itself.

Day 2: Tuesday 23 March Napier B,L,D

After breakfast you will set off on a Guided Art Deco Trust Walking Tour. On this tour you will delve into the world’s largest concentration of 1930’s Art Deco, Spanish Mission, and Stripped Classical buildings. The city was rebuilt over a two year period after the 1931 Napier earthquake capturing the beauty and nuance of the popular architectural styles of the early 1930’s. Your Art Deco Trust guide will show you many of the hidden treasures of this magnificent city.

After the conclusion of your Art Deco Walking Tour you will head to Mission Estate Winery for a wine tasting and lunch. Established in 1851 by a group of French Missionaries. Today it boasts an enviable setting, with stunning views out over Hawke’s Bay in a beautiful historic building. Day 3: Wednesday 24 March Napier B,L,D

This morning you will board the coach to head to the quaint township of Havelock North along the way you will climb up toward Te Mata Peak for some spectacular views back towards Napier and over the Tuki Tuki river. Havelock North offers boutique shopping, a thriving café culture and although just kilometres from Hastings the town, locally known as ‘the village’ feels miles away.

After exploring the streets of Havelock North you will travel to the coastal town of Te Awanga and visit Clearview Winery for lunch. Established in 1987, owner-operated Clearview Estate's ‘Red Shed’ Restaurant and cellar door are long-established havens of Mediterranean inspired hospitality. You will partake in a wine tasting prior to your lunch at the restaurant. Following this we will be picked up by Gannet Safaris Overland for a tour of the gannet colony. You will be transported in their modern fleet of 4x4 vehicles through pristine coastline, working farms, native bush and to New Zealand’s largest privately-owned nature reserve.

An adventure in itself, you will safari in style and comfort over picturesque Cape Kidnappers Station traversing riverbeds, broad rolling pastures, steep gullies and the most breath taking views of Hawkes Bay and beyond. With no walking required, you are whisked away to an untouched paradise for wildlife including gannets and a predator free space for kiwi birds and other rare birds to roam.
